How many times have you ever seen a woman with a Bluetooth headset? Not many, right? But if a woman were to be offered the above Bluetooth headsets designed by Ilya Fridman, I am pretty sure she will not decline. With no ugly ear hooks that come as a part of any contemporary headset, these style icons need only a flip of the mic downwards or pressing in the center to activate the talk function. We are pretty sure this idea will sell if it ever becomes a reality, but what matters more is, does Jabra think so too?

You might remember the Nokia Aeon concept phone we’ve shown you quite a while ago. It’s a phone we really wished for. Nokia failed to fulfill our dreams yet but other people also remembered the Aeon. Designer Jeffrey Gerlach has invented a phone that comes with a dual multi-touch OLED screen. Similar to the Aeon you say? So do I! It’s called the Ripple and it will also feature an alphanumeric keypad but also a virtual QWERTY keyboard and a mini USB port. There’s a 5 megapixel camera and an integrated handgrip. We’d definitely love to check one live? Will anyone start manufacturing the Ripple?

Ripple note has unveiled a new tablet notebook at VIP Asia. This laptop has been featured on this site a few months before but and it has made an appearance at VIP Asia 2008. As we mentioned, the Ripple Tablet T8100 features:
Penryn Intel Core 2 Duo T8100 (2.1GHz. 3MB)
Intel GM965 + ICH8M
12.1 TFT LCD touch panel (resolution 1280 * 800)
1GB DDR2 667MHz mounting
ODD Super Multi dual-layer DVD recorder
2.5 inches SATA HDD 120GB
The Ripple Tablet T8100 comes factory-installed with Windows Vista, although you could also opt for Windows XP.

Ripple, a Korean manufacturer, has a new 12.1 inch notebook called the Ripple Note T2450. Featuring an Intel Core 2 Duo T2450 processor (2.0 GHz), the laptop offers a 12.1 inch widescreen WXGA TFT LCD at 1280×800 pixels. There’s 1 GB of DDR2 RAM (667MHz) and a generous 120 GB SATA hard drive. For connectivity, the Ripple Note is equipped with 802.11 b/g support. The case is designed to be lightweight and it comes in a curved surface finishing.
Other goodies include a 7-in-1 card reader, and integrated 1.3 megapixel webcam.
